You need to wrap you alertEnded... method with PyObjcTools.Apphelper.endSheetMethod:
@PyObjcTools.Apphelper.endSheetMethod def alertEnded(self, alert, choice, context): ... (Methods wrapped with endSheetMethod don't need the ObjC name mangling, so you can name it whatever you want.) I have a very weak understanding of why this is needed, but it's something related to sheet callback methods not having a fixed signature.
